Subwoofer box

Does any one know the biggest size sub box that will fit good in
the trunk ? length width height ? and has anybody used or heard what the custom fit ones from Q logic sound like the one they make special fit and color to match your interior with either 2 10's or 12's ?

The Q-logic boxes are not worth the money. They flex too much. Check out www.subthump.com As far as the LARGEST box you can fit back there..... depends. Are you willing to remove those two side plastic panels, the spare tire and jack? Are we using wood or is fiberglass doable?

Using 3/4" MDF, I've got a 3.95 cubic foot enclosure in mine. I can even expand it a tad here and there and get a little more space. I think I can get 4 cubic feet out of the full well using MDF.

I have a deep well Ttop box FS that has a lil more than 1.5 cubic feet per 12 inch sub (2 12's, specifically brahmas). You can still use the ttops piggybacked, and can be seen on subthumps site. Its an awesome box and the brahmas absolutely pounded in it. I'm sure if you wanted to go with one sub or share the airspace with several subs you could squeeze out more, like lwillman did.
